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
An Outline of Metal Polishing - Generally, metal finishing is essential for appearance or clean-room situations. It's one of the more effective techniques because of its use in improving upon the natural attractiveness of the item, for example, motorcycle parts, auto parts or cookware. In addition, lots of clean-rooms must have a burnished finish in order to lessen the perviousness of the metal surfaces which might result in dust to collect and contaminate. An excellent instance of this usage would be in vacuum chambers. You'll discover numerous different ways to finish metals, and we'll consider the various techniques involved. Metals can be polished electromechanically, chemically, by hand, or with specialized buffing machines. A buffing compound or paste is commonly utilised, which could consist of ch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its lousy th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its quite high viscidness is amongst the time-consuming. On the flip side, items produced from non-ferrous metals are definitely more responsive to polishing, simply because these call for the least number of processes.
If a superior processing quality is simply not crucial, faster pad speeds can be utilized. A lower pad speed is applied in the event that a high quality mirror finish is crucial. Finishing buffs coated in paste are greatly impacted by the load on the surface of the buffing pad. The severity of the surface pressure can be increased within certain bounds, although further surpassing the maximum measure of force not just cuts down on the quality of the procedure, but additionally can worsen effectiveness, can create wear to the part, plus there is also an obvious heating up of the work-pieces, generated by friction. When you are working on thinner material, it is higher temperature (and a relating flexibility of the material) that causes materials to buckle, twist or flex. In general, it needs a talented polisher to take into consideration every one of these fundamentals to both prevent harm to the workpiece and to get the project done adequately. For you to appreciably increase the standard of the resulting finish, the finishing process should really be executed with not as much vigour and not so much pressure in order to subsequently deliver a surface devoid of scores or fine lines resulting from the buffing procedure, therefore arriving at a fabulous mirror finish.
